The Cost Of Short Term Drug and Alcohol Rehabilitation in Frankenmuth, Michigan

Most people suffering from drug addiction typically feel the cost of rehab is too steep for them. Therefore, they may choose to opt out of receiving treatment - not realizing that addiction is always more expensive in the long-term.

Contingent on the method of treatment you choose, the facility will likely require you to take care of the rather expensive costs. Yet, there are reasonably affordable options in Frankenmuth that you can take advantage of to reduce these costs - including short term drug rehabilitation.

Short term rehab is typically less expensive than long-term rehab due to the fact that you will only undergo rehabilitation for a short amount of time. This means that here you have a lower priced alternative that you can benefit from to help you resolve your substance abuse and addiction.

In some cases, you might even learn that your insurance company will cover the cost of rehab if you choose short term treatment. Although, many insurances have limits on the total amount they may pay out - or the total number of days in treatment that they will cover. Still, many short term rehab programs are sufficiently covered by insurance.

Thus, if the expense of rehab is a significant consideration for you, short term rehabilitation might be the best way forward. As much as you might want to receive the best, most comprehensive type of treatment, your funds might keep you from choosing more comprehensive options such as long term drug and alcohol treatment.

Even with this rather low cost, short term drug and alcohol rehabilitation might work for you. Although, the effectiveness of the rehab program will primarily depend on you as an individual. If your substance abuse has been ongoing for a long period of time, for instance, it is highly doubtful that this duration of rehabilitation will be successful in the long-run for you. This is because it is more appropriate for individuals who have only just started showing early symptoms of substance abuse and addiction.

Ultimately, short term treatment is ideal for addicts who have not been abusing drugs for a long time and for those who cannot afford a longer rehab program.

Flint Odyssey House Inc Residential/Outpatient Program

(Serving the Frankenmuth area, Flint Odyssey House Inc is 23.3 miles from Frankenmuth, Michigan)

Flint Odyssey House Inc Residential/Outpatient Program
529 Martin Luther King Jr Avenue
Flint, MI. 48502
810-238-7226
Flint and Saginaw Odyssey House drug and alcohol treatment programs continue as the heart of the Odyssey Village holistic and comprehensive recovery management service array. In addition to providing residential and outpatient drug and alcohol treatment services in both Flint and Saginaw, the Odyssey Village includes a virtual village of services that recognizes addiction as a chronic problem that requires a long term relationship through a therapeutic community.
